| MAME version | Can run 0.119 ROMs? | Notes | |--------------|----------------------|-------| | 0.119 (same) | ✅ Yes | Perfect match | | 0.118–0.120 | ✅ Mostly | Minor parent/clone changes possible | | 0.150+ | ⚠️ Partial | Many will fail audit; need ROM fix tools | | 0.200+ | ❌ Rarely | Only the most common games (Pac-Man, etc.) might work | | 0.250+ | ❌ Almost never | CHD mismatches, renamed ROMs, missing BIOS splits |

Over the last 15+ years, the MAME team renamed thousands of files to match the actual labels on the physical chips.
